About Philip M. Parker
Philip M. Parker is an American economist and academic, and currently the INSEAD Chaired Professor of Management Science at INSEAD in Fontainebleau, France. He has patented a method to automatically produce a set of similar books from a template that is filled with data from databases and Internet searches. He is the creator of Webster's Online Dictionary: The Rosetta Edition, a multilingual online dictionary created in 1999. One book, The 2009-2014 World Outlook for 60-milligram Containers of Fromage Frais, won the 2008 Bookseller/Diagram Prize for Oddest Title of the Year.
